Starbucks Corporation $SBUX Shares Sold by LPL Financial LLC

LPL Financial LLC lessened its holdings in shares of Starbucks Corporation (NASDAQ:SBUXFree Report) by 8.0% in the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The firm owned 2,658,766 shares of the coffee company’s stock after selling 232,289 shares during the period. LPL Financial LLC’s holdings in Starbucks were worth $223,895,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Starbucks Trading Up 2.7%

Shares of NASDAQ SBUX opened at $97.41 on Wednesday. The company has a market cap of $111.02 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 73.80,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.87 and a beta of 0.98. Starbucks Corporation has a 12-month low of $77.99 and a 12-month high of $108.88. The stock’s 50 day simple moving average is $99.52 and its 200 day simple moving average is $94.35.

Starbucks (NASDAQ:SBUXG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April 28th. The coffee company reported $0.50 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.44 by $0.06. The business had revenue of $9.53 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$9.17 billion. Starbucks had a negative return on equity of 29.24% and a net margin of 3.89%.The business’s revenue was up 8.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.41 EPS. Starbucks has set its FY 2026 guidance at 2.250-2.450 EPS. As a group, equities analysts forecast that Starbucks Corporation will post 2.42 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Starbucks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 29th. Investors of record on Friday, May 15th were issued a $0.62 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, May 15th. This represents a $2.48 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.5%. Starbucks’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 187.88%.

Starbucks Profile

(Free Report)

Starbucks Corporation is a global coffeehouse chain and roaster that operates, licenses and franchises coffee shops and related retail businesses. Founded in Seattle, Washington in 1971 by Jerry Baldwin, Zev Siegl and Gordon Bowker, the company grew from a single store focused on whole-bean coffee and equipment into a broad consumer-facing brand. Howard Schultz, who joined the company later and served in senior leadership roles, is widely credited with transforming Starbucks into a mass-market specialty coffee retailer and expanding its footprint internationally.

Starbucks’ core activities center on the retail sale of hot and cold specialty beverages, whole-bean and packaged coffees, teas and ready-to-drink products, along with complementary food items and merchandise such as mugs and brewing equipment.
